Cookies
If you leave a comment, you may opt-in to saving your name, email, and website in cookies. These are for your convenience so that you don’t have to re-enter your details for future comments. These cookies last for one year.
When you visit our login page, we set a temporary cookie to check if your browser accepts cookies. This cookie contains no personal data and is discarded when you close your browser.
When you log in, we set up cookies to save your login credentials and screen display preferences. Login cookies last for two days and screen options cookies last for one year. Selecting “Remember Me” extends the login cookie duration to two weeks. If you log out of your account, the login cookies will be removed.
If you edit or publish an article, an additional cookie is saved in your browser. This cookie does not contain personal data and only stores the post ID of the edited article. It expires after one day.
